TensorLy
========

TensorLy is a fast and simple Python library for tensor learning. It builds on top of NumPy, SciPy and MXNet and allows for fast and straightforward tensor decomposition, tensor learning and tensor algebra.

How to install
--------------
 
Easy option: install with pip
~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~

Simply run::

   pip install -U tensorly
   
NOTE: TensorLy is developed/tested only for Python 3

That's it!

Alternatively, you can pip install from the git repository::

   pip install git+https://github.com/tensorly/tensorly

Development: install from git
~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~

The library is still very new and under heavy developement. To install the last version:

Clone the repository and cd there::

   git clone https://github.com/tensorly/tensorly
   cd tensorly

Then install the package (here in editable mode with `-e` or equivalently `--editable`)::

   pip install -e .

Running the tests
~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~

Testing and documentation are an essential part of this package and all functions come with uni-tests and documentation.

You can run all the tests using the `nose` package::

   nosetests -v tensorly
